3. Argos

Argos is among the UK's most trusted and well-established retailers, has a policy of price matching that ensures its customers get the best deal for their money. Argos also believes in transparency and trust, promoting feedback from customers to create an enduring relationship with its customers.

Argos was previously known as Green Shield Stamps and began trading in 1973. The company is most famous for its high-end catalogue shops, where customers would fill out a form with the catalogue number of their desired item. Customers could also pay for their purchases at a Quick Pay kiosk and then collect them from the stockroom.

Since Sainsbury's acquired the company, many Argos standalone stores have been converted to Sainsbury's Click & Collect points. The company currently operates a network which includes more than 650 shops in England, Wales, and Northern Ireland.

6. Home Bargains

Home Bargains is a UK discount retailer with 506 stores selling branded general merchandise at low prices. Tom Morris founded it in 1976 in Liverpool. Morris began his business, according to reports, by securing a bank loan.

The company is proud how to ship to ireland from uk offer the best brands at reasonable prices. Customers can find a variety of toiletries, cleaning supplies and pantry staples such as baked beans, pasta rice, and more. The chain also sells fresh vegetables and fruits.

One thing to remember when shopping at Home Bargains is that their inventory rotates frequently. The company says that their stores are usually replenished by 7am, so it's best to go early. Shoppers can determine the current status of an item by looking at its price tag - it will be marked either REG or one.

7. Marks and Spencer

M&S is a major department retailer in the United Kingdom. The company sells a wide assortment of furniture, clothing and home products under private-label labels. The food division of the company is a major part.

M&S has a long-standing tradition of promoting quality, particularly in regards to customer service. In the early 20th century M&S was among the first retailers to allow customers to return items they did not want and receive a full refund in cash.

M&S has opened many new stores in the past few years. The retailer has recently opened or renovated stores in Purley, Croydon White Rose Centre, Leeds Liverpool ONE and Stockport this year alone. Each new Marks and Spencer location is designed with families from the local area in mind. The store has free parking and food halls that are in the style of an open market.
